Output 134104896766b9cddfeaf24ad119b02bca07a689489c364f49b82cfad26d1a91:0

value
19294100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b924a5ec33415d2e420788b9d468b6173e426ef OP_EQUAL
address
3JnoXrm8yhyCZnvqEfsG4135hiDZrWtK2w
transaction
134104896766b9cddfeaf24ad119b02bca07a689489c364f49b82cfad26d1a91
spent
true